Jan 13: Max Blumenthal, America Jew,author of the 2013 book Goliath: life and loathing in greater Israel https://facebook/events/880028008714920/?context=create&previousaction=create&source=49&sid_create=2300794575 Next in the Crisis in the Holy Land video/discussion series sponsored by the Helena Service for Peace and Justice and the Montana Coalition for Palestine -- Tuesday, January 13, 6:30pm, Helena library -- In Goliath, New York Times bestselling author Max Blumenthal takes us on a journey through the badlands and high roads of Israel-Palestine, painting a startling portrait of Israeli society under the siege of increasingly authoritarian politics as the occupation of the Palestinians deepens. Beginning with the national elections carried out during Israels war on Gaza in 2008-09, which brought into power the countrys most right-wing government to date, Blumenthal tells the story of Israel in the wake of the collapse of the Oslo peace process. Blumenthal interviews the demagogues and divas in their homes, in the Knesset, and in the watering holes where their young acolytes hang out, and speaks with those political leaders behind the organized assault on civil liberties. As his journey deepens, he painstakingly reports on the occupied Palestinians challenging schemes of demographic separation through unarmed protest. He talks at length to the leaders and youth of Palestinian society inside Israel now targeted by security service dragnets and legislation suppressing their speech, and provides in-depth reporting on the small band of Jewish Israeli dissidents who have shaken off a conformist mindset that permeates the media, schools, and the military. ------------------------------------------------------ Series began on December 9 with a video of Israeli Jew Miko Peled Speaking Out About Israel… Peled is the son of an Israeli General-Turned-Peacemaker. January 13: videos of American Jews Speaking Out About Israel (Max Blumenthal, author of Goliath) February 10: videos of Palestinians Speaking Out About Israel (possibly: Mazin Qumsiyeh, Hanan Daoud Khalil Ashrawi) Miko Peled Speaking Out About Israel… See Video: An honest Israeli Jew tells the Real Truth about Israel : https://youtube/watch?v=etXAm-OylQQ&feature=youtu.be Miko Peled: mikopeled/ and electronicintifada.net/people/miko-peled and https://youtube/watch?v=c4ZfnpN4Dfc Miko Peled is a peace activist who dares to say in public what others still choose to deny. Born in Jerusalem in 1961 into a well known Zionist family, his grandfather, Dr. Avraham Katsnelson was a Zionist leader and signer of the Israeli Declaration of Independence. His Father, Matti Peled, was a young officer in the war of 1948 and a general in the war of 1967 when Israel conquered the West Bank, Gaza, Golan Heights and Sinai. Keep in mind he is a Jew.” Video of Ilan Pappé speaking about Israel’s ethnic cleansing campaign: https://youtube/watch?v=buhpHTGAlTE _______________________________________ Date TBA in January, 2015: Helena SERPAJ will show the Center for Constitutional Rights (CCR) short documentary Waiting for Fahd: One Family’s Hope for Life Beyond Guantánamo (see ccrjustice.org/fahd) which tells the story of CCR client Fahd Ghazy, who has been illegally detained at Guantánamo since he was 17. He is now 30 years old. Through moving interviews with his family in Yemen, the film paints a vivid portrait of the life that awaits a man who, despite being twice cleared for release, continues to needlessly languish at Guantánamo because of his nationality. A heartbreaking tale of a dream deferred, “Waiting for Fahd” is also a story about the durability of hope. Omar Farah of CCR writes: “Over Thanksgiving, I met with Fahd in Guantánamo.
